Output 121479707299350e8f17c1b2de84e9753999d724af1e939ad117ad2d8e39b69e:0

value
75000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dd0704f1262bc8e3696314b4ad5cc1f28cfec89 OP_EQUAL
address
3DAG66dCM9iFygjtGu5fy1gYGAqktAFVM2
transaction
121479707299350e8f17c1b2de84e9753999d724af1e939ad117ad2d8e39b69e
spent
true